beer, alcoholic beverage produced by extracting raw materials with water, boiling (usually with hops), and fermenting. In some countries beer is defined by lawβ€”as in Germany, where the standard ingredients, besides water, are malt (kiln-dried germinated barley), hops, and yeast.
